VOL. XL No. 2126-May-1997IRANSouth Korea To Build Five New Tankers For NIOC
The National Iranian Oil Company (NIOC) is to buy five crudetankers from South Korea under an agreement signed on 21 May in Seoul during the visit ofthe Iranian Oil Minister, Mr. Gholamreza Aghazadeh, to South Korea. According to an IRNAreport, the vessels will raise the total capacity of Iran's tanker fleet to 4mn tons andare expected to be delivered within two years.
